Recognizing the Benefits of HDPE Pipeline
High-density polyethylene (HDPE) pipeline provides various benefits that make it a recommended choice for different applications. Its high resistance to corrosion and chemicals guarantees toughness sought after settings, considerably expanding the life-span of installments. Additionally, HDPE's flexibility allows for simpler installation, specifically in challenging terrains, as it can bend without breaking. The lightweight nature of HDPE pipe streamlines transport and handling, decreasing labor expenses throughout installation.
Additionally, HDPE pipeline is known for its reduced friction coefficient, which boosts fluid circulation and decreases power intake. Its seamless building and construction minimizes the threat of leakages, adding to much better resource management and ecological protection. Furthermore, HDPE is recyclable, aligning with sustainable techniques and decreasing ecological impact. Generally, the combination of toughness, adaptability, and eco-friendliness makes HDPE pipeline an exceptional option for a large range of tasks, from water distribution to commercial applications.

Strategies for Joining HDPE Water Lines
Achieving a reliable connection between HDPE pipes is necessary for making sure the stability and longevity of the installment. Different techniques exist for signing up with these pipelines, each fit for different project demands. Fusion welding is just one of the most usual methods, using warm to bond the pipe finishes with each other, developing a seamless and resilient link. This strategy can be additional categorized into socket fusion and butt fusion, relying on the pipe setups.
Mechanical installations are an additional option, utilizing clamps and threaded connectors to join sections of HDPE pipe. While usually faster to install, they might require extra upkeep over time. Electrofusion is a specialized method that involves utilizing electric existing to warm and fuse the pipes through specially developed installations, ensuring a strong bond. Choosing the proper joining method is important, as it directly affects the total efficiency and reliability of the HDPE piping system in the intended application.

Stress Examining Techniques
Visual examination offers as an initial measure, yet it is not adequate on its very own to ensure the performance of installed HDPE this article pipelines. Pressure testing methods are vital for guaranteeing the honesty of these systems. Normally, hydrostatic screening is utilized, where the pipelines are loaded with water and subjected to pressure degrees over the designated operating pressure. This technique aids determine weak points or potential leaks. Pneumatic testing can additionally be made use of, although it brings greater dangers as a result of the compressibility of air. Despite the method selected, adhering to sector standards and safety protocols is crucial. After performing pressure examinations, thorough documents is necessary to validate the outcomes and confirm that the setup satisfies all operational needs before proceeding to the next phase of the task.
Leak Discovery Treatments
Exactly how can one assure that mounted HDPE pipes are cost-free from leakages? Efficient leakage detection treatments are vital to protect the integrity of the system. Originally, aesthetic assessments ought to be done, seeking indicators of water accumulation or soil disintegration around pipeline joints. Following this, stress screening can confirm the system's toughness. A common approach is the hydrostatic examination, where water is introduced under pressure, keeping an eye on for declines that indicate prospective leakages. In addition, progressed innovations, such as acoustic sensing units or infrared thermography, can detect leakages that may not be noticeable. Normal monitoring and maintenance further add to the durability of HDPE pipes, guaranteeing they remain leak-free throughout their operational lifespan. Correct documents of these procedures is vital for compliance and future recommendation.

Appropriate Cleansing Techniques
Appropriate cleansing techniques play a vital function in keeping the long-term performance of HDPE pipelines. Regular cleaning prevents the buildup of debris, debris, and biofilm, which can cause blockages and reduced flow effectiveness. Operators ought to use methods such as high-pressure water jetting or foam cleaning to efficiently eliminate impurities without damaging the pipeline surface area. It is vital to stay clear of utilizing severe chemicals that may weaken HDPE product. Furthermore, arranged upkeep checks should include visual examinations for any signs of wear or damages.
